Class DefaultUserAuditProcessor
java.lang.Object
com.atlassian.crowd.dao.audit.processor.impl.DefaultUserAuditProcessor
- All Implemented Interfaces:
UserAuditProcessor
-
Constructor Summary
ConstructorDescriptionDefaultUserAuditProcessor
(AuditDao auditDao, DirectoryDao directoryDao, AuditLogChangesetPopulator auditLogChangesetPopulator, AuditLogUserMapper auditLogUserMapper, AuditLogMetadataResolver auditLogMetadataResolver) -
Method Summary
Modifier and TypeMethodDescriptionvoid
auditCredentialUpdated
(InternalUser userToUpdate) void
auditUserAdded
(InternalUser user) void
auditUserAttributesUpdated
(InternalUser internalUser, org.apache.commons.lang3.builder.DiffResult<?> changeSet) void
auditUserRemoved
(InternalUser user) void
auditUserUpdated
(User oldUser, InternalUser updatedUser)
-
Constructor Details
-
DefaultUserAuditProcessor
public DefaultUserAuditProcessor(AuditDao auditDao, DirectoryDao directoryDao, AuditLogChangesetPopulator auditLogChangesetPopulator, AuditLogUserMapper auditLogUserMapper, AuditLogMetadataResolver auditLogMetadataResolver)
-
-
Method Details
-
auditBulkAddUsers
- Specified by:
auditBulkAddUsers
in interfaceUserAuditProcessor
-
auditBulkRemoveUsers
- Specified by:
auditBulkRemoveUsers
in interfaceUserAuditProcessor
-
auditUserAdded
- Specified by:
auditUserAdded
in interfaceUserAuditProcessor
-
auditUserRemoved
- Specified by:
auditUserRemoved
in interfaceUserAuditProcessor
-
auditUserUpdated
- Specified by:
auditUserUpdated
in interfaceUserAuditProcessor
-
auditCredentialUpdated
- Specified by:
auditCredentialUpdated
in interfaceUserAuditProcessor
-
auditUserAttributesUpdated
public void auditUserAttributesUpdated(InternalUser internalUser, org.apache.commons.lang3.builder.DiffResult<?> changeSet) - Specified by:
auditUserAttributesUpdated
in interfaceUserAuditProcessor
-